GOSHEN, Utah County — One driver was killed and another was critically injured in a crash that closed U.S. Highway 6 near Goshen Thursday morning.

About 5:48 a.m., a Chevy Impala was driving east on U.S. 6 when a westbound Ford F-150 crossed the center line into oncoming traffic for "unknown reasons," the Utah Highway Patrol said in a statement.

The truck hit the car head-on, killing the car's driver on impact. The driver of the truck was flown to an area hospital in critical condition.

"Possible impairment is being investigated as a contributor to this crash," troopers said.

U.S. 6 was closed in both directions for several hours about a mile east of Goshen until 10:30 a.m., according to the Utah Department of Transportation.
